Understanding TMJ disorders is crucial for those seeking effective solutions to alleviate jaw pain. The temporomandibular joint (TMJ) connects the jawbone to the skull, and disorders in this area can lead to discomfort, headaches, and difficulty in jaw movement. Botox treatment for TMJ relief has emerged as a precise method to address these issues by targeting the muscles responsible for tension and pain.

TMJ disorders can arise from various factors, including stress, teeth grinding, or arthritis. These conditions can significantly impact daily life, making it essential to explore options like Botox treatment for TMJ relief. Botox Mechanism for TMJ Relief

Botox treatment for TMJ relief works by targeting the muscles responsible for jaw tension and pain. When injected into specific areas, Botox temporarily paralyzes the overactive muscles, reducing their ability to contract and thus alleviating the discomfort associated with TMJ disorders. This reduction in muscle activity can lead to a significant decrease in jaw pain, headaches, and other symptoms related to TMJ dysfunction.

The precision of Botox injections allows for targeted relief, focusing on the exact muscles contributing to the TMJ issues. This approach not only helps in easing the immediate pain but also prevents further strain on the jaw muscles. Symptoms of TMJ Disorders

TMJ disorders can manifest through a variety of symptoms that may affect daily life. Common indicators include persistent jaw pain, difficulty chewing, and a clicking or popping sound when opening or closing the mouth. Some individuals may experience headaches, earaches, or even facial pain. These symptoms can vary in intensity and duration, often leading to discomfort and frustration. Potential Side Effects

When considering Botox treatment for TMJ relief, it’s important to be aware of potential side effects. While many individuals experience significant relief from jaw pain, some may encounter temporary side effects such as mild bruising, swelling, or tenderness at the injection site. In rare cases, patients might experience headaches or flu-like symptoms. It’s crucial to discuss any concerns with a healthcare professional to ensure a comprehensive understanding of the treatment’s implications.

Duration of Relief

The duration of relief from Botox treatment for TMJ relief can vary among individuals, but many experience a significant reduction in jaw pain and discomfort for several months. Typically, the effects of the injections last between three to six months, providing a temporary respite from the symptoms associated with TMJ disorders. This variability in duration is influenced by factors such as individual response to the treatment and the severity of the condition.
